2025年物联网软件开发测试认证试题_第1页
2025年物联网软件开发测试认证试题_第2页
2025年物联网软件开发测试认证试题_第3页
2025年物联网软件开发测试认证试题_第4页
2025年物联网软件开发测试认证试题_第5页
已阅读5页,还剩14页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

2025年物联网软件开发测试认证试题考试时长:120分钟满分:100分试卷名称:2025年物联网软件开发测试认证试题考核对象:物联网软件开发测试领域从业者及学习者题型分值分布:-判断题(10题,每题2分)总分20分-单选题(10题,每题2分)总分20分-多选题(10题,每题2分)总分20分-案例分析(3题,每题6分)总分18分-论述题(2题,每题11分)总分22分总分:100分---一、判断题(每题2分,共20分)请判断下列说法的正误。1.物联网软件开发测试中,自动化测试主要用于验证硬件设备的物理交互功能。2.MQTT协议在物联网应用中通常用于低带宽、高延迟的网络环境。3.模糊测试是一种通过随机输入数据检测系统漏洞的测试方法。4.物联网设备的固件更新通常采用分阶段、灰度发布策略以降低风险。5.API测试在物联网软件开发中主要用于验证设备与云平台的数据传输接口。6.代码覆盖率是衡量测试用例设计质量的重要指标之一。7.物联网测试中,性能测试主要关注设备的响应时间和并发处理能力。8.安全测试在物联网软件开发中通常在开发后期进行,以减少修复成本。9.模拟器是物联网测试中常用的工具,可以完全替代真实设备的测试环境。10.物联网软件开发测试中,回归测试的目的是验证新功能是否影响原有功能。二、单选题(每题2分,共20分)请选择最符合题意的选项。1.以下哪种协议不属于物联网常见的通信协议?A.HTTPB.CoAPC.FTPD.Zigbee2.物联网软件开发测试中,以下哪种测试方法最适合验证设备的数据采集准确性?A.黑盒测试B.白盒测试C.灰盒测试D.模糊测试3.在物联网测试中,以下哪种工具主要用于模拟网络环境的不稳定性?A.PostmanB.JMeterC.CharlesD.GNS34.物联网设备的固件更新通常采用哪种发布策略以降低风险?A.全量发布B.灰度发布C.A/B测试D.分阶段发布5.以下哪种测试方法最适合验证物联网设备的低功耗性能?A.性能测试B.安全测试C.可靠性测试D.稳定性测试6.物联网软件开发测试中,以下哪种测试用例设计方法最适合验证设备的数据传输完整性?A.等价类划分B.边界值分析C.决策表测试D.用例设计7.在物联网测试中,以下哪种测试方法主要用于验证设备的异常处理能力?A.功能测试B.性能测试C.安全测试D.压力测试8.物联网软件开发测试中,以下哪种测试工具最适合进行API测试?A.SeleniumB.PostmanC.AppiumD.Katalon9.在物联网测试中,以下哪种测试方法最适合验证设备的网络连接稳定性?A.功能测试B.性能测试C.可靠性测试D.安全测试10.物联网软件开发测试中,以下哪种测试用例设计方法最适合验证设备的用户权限管理功能?A.等价类划分B.边界值分析C.决策表测试D.用例设计三、多选题(每题2分,共20分)请选择所有符合题意的选项。1.物联网软件开发测试中,以下哪些测试方法属于黑盒测试?A.功能测试B.系统测试C.单元测试D.集成测试2.物联网设备的固件更新过程中,以下哪些环节需要测试?A.更新包的完整性B.更新过程的稳定性C.更新后的功能恢复D.更新失败的处理机制3.在物联网测试中,以下哪些工具可以用于模拟真实设备的网络环境?A.GNS3B.WiresharkC.CharlesD.NetworkSimulator34.物联网软件开发测试中,以下哪些测试用例设计方法可以用于验证设备的数据采集准确性?A.等价类划分B.边界值分析C.决策表测试D.用例设计5.在物联网测试中,以下哪些测试方法可以用于验证设备的安全性能?A.渗透测试B.模糊测试C.安全扫描D.静态代码分析6.物联网软件开发测试中,以下哪些测试用例设计方法可以用于验证设备的异常处理能力?A.等价类划分B.边界值分析C.决策表测试D.用例设计7.在物联网测试中,以下哪些测试方法可以用于验证设备的网络连接稳定性?A.功能测试B.性能测试C.可靠性测试D.安全测试8.物联网软件开发测试中,以下哪些测试工具可以用于进行API测试?A.PostmanB.JMeterC.SoapUID.Katalon9.在物联网测试中,以下哪些测试方法可以用于验证设备的低功耗性能?A.性能测试B.可靠性测试C.稳定性测试D.环境测试10.物联网软件开发测试中,以下哪些测试用例设计方法可以用于验证设备的用户权限管理功能?A.等价类划分B.边界值分析C.决策表测试D.用例设计四、案例分析(每题6分,共18分)1.案例背景:某物联网公司开发了一款智能农业设备,用于监测土壤湿度、温度和光照强度。设备通过MQTT协议将数据传输至云平台,用户可通过手机APP查看实时数据。在测试过程中发现,设备在低光照环境下数据采集不准确,且APP在大量用户同时访问时响应缓慢。问题:-请分析该案例中涉及哪些测试类型?-请提出至少三种测试方法或工具用于解决上述问题。2.案例背景:某智能家居公司开发了一套智能门锁系统,用户可通过手机APP或语音助手进行开锁操作。在测试过程中发现,系统在特定网络环境下(如弱信号区域)无法正常开锁,且固件更新过程中存在数据丢失风险。问题:-请分析该案例中涉及哪些测试类型?-请提出至少三种测试方法或工具用于解决上述问题。3.案例背景:某工业物联网公司开发了一套智能传感器,用于监测生产线设备的振动和温度。设备通过CoAP协议将数据传输至云平台,并在设备故障时触发报警。在测试过程中发现,传感器在高温环境下数据采集不准确,且报警机制存在误报问题。问题:-请分析该案例中涉及哪些测试类型?-请提出至少三种测试方法或工具用于解决上述问题。五、论述题(每题11分,共22分)1.题目:请论述物联网软件开发测试中,自动化测试与手动测试的优缺点,并说明在哪些场景下应优先选择自动化测试。2.题目:请论述物联网软件开发测试中,安全测试的重要性,并说明常见的物联网安全测试方法及工具。---标准答案及解析一、判断题1.×(自动化测试主要用于验证软件逻辑和接口,而非硬件物理交互)2.√3.√4.√5.√6.√7.√8.×(安全测试应在开发早期进行,以减少修复成本)9.×(模拟器无法完全替代真实设备,但可辅助测试)10.√二、单选题1.C(FTP不属于物联网常见通信协议)2.A(黑盒测试最适合验证数据采集准确性)3.D(NetworkSimulator3主要用于模拟网络环境)4.B(灰度发布最适合降低固件更新风险)5.C(可靠性测试最适合验证低功耗性能)6.B(边界值分析最适合验证数据传输完整性)7.C(安全测试最适合验证异常处理能力)8.B(Postman最适合进行API测试)9.C(可靠性测试最适合验证网络连接稳定性)10.C(决策表测试最适合验证用户权限管理功能)三、多选题1.A,B(功能测试和系统测试属于黑盒测试)2.A,B,C,D3.A,D(GNS3和NetworkSimulator3可模拟真实设备网络环境)4.A,B(等价类划分和边界值分析可验证数据采集准确性)5.A,B,C,D6.B,C(边界值分析和决策表测试可验证异常处理能力)7.B,C(性能测试和可靠性测试可验证网络连接稳定性)8.A,C,D(Postman、SoapUI和Katalon可进行API测试)9.B,C,D(可靠性测试、稳定性测试和环境测试可验证低功耗性能)10.C,D(决策表测试和用例设计可验证用户权限管理功能)四、案例分析1.问题1:-测试类型:功能测试、性能测试、环境测试。-解决方法:-使用模拟器模拟低光照环境,验证数据采集准确性。-使用JMeter进行压力测试,优化APP响应速度。-使用Postman测试MQTT协议的传输稳定性。2.问题2:-测试类型:功能测试、安全测试、固件测试。-解决方法:-使用网络模拟器模拟弱信号环境,优化系统稳定性。-使用渗透测试工具检测系统漏洞。-使用灰度发布策略降低固件更新风险。3.问题3:-测试类型:功能测试、性能测试、环境测试。-解决方法:-使用环境测试工具模拟高温环境,验证数据采集准确性。-使用模糊测试工具检测报警机制的误报问题。-使用Postman测试CoAP协议的传输稳定性。五、论述题1.自动化测试与手动测试的优缺点及适用场景:-自动化测试的优点:-提高测试效率,减少人工错误。-可重复执行,确保测试覆盖率。-适用于回归测试和性能测试。-自动化测试的缺点:-初始投入成本高,需要编写测试脚本。-不适用于探索性测试。-手动测试的优点:-灵活性强,适用于探索性测试。-成本低,无需编写脚本。-手动测试的缺点:-效率低,易受人为因素影响。-难以重复执行。-适用场景:-自动化测试:回归测试、性能测试、API测试。-手动测试:探索性测试、用户体验测试。2.物联网安全测试的重要性及方法工具:-重要性:

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

最新文档

评论

0/150

提交评论